* Richmond County Health Department is a Medicaid Dentist. Richmond County Health Department is not a free clinic. Read the services description below to see if you qualify for Medicaid services at this dental office.

Richmond County Health Department  dental office serves Medicaid patients as a Health Department in Rockingham, NC. They may or may not be accepting new patients at this time. If you are on Medicaid in North Carolina, you must check with the office to see if you can be seen for a dental problem.
